Accessing your music is made simpler with Beoremote Halo: the new Bang & Olufsen remote control that plays your favourite music, podcasts, and internet radio stations with a single touch.

A welcome addition to Bang & Olufsen’s portfolio of high-end loudspeakers, Beoremote Halo is at once a highly functional remote control and a sculptural object in its own right. A crafted aluminium ring, which appears to float in mid-air, encircles a discrete console; it can be mounted on the wall like a piece of art or stand on its own, allowing users to move the product freely throughout the home. When approaching Beoremote Halo, the display screen illuminates, allowing the user to choose their favourite music or radio. Controlling the volume offers a luxurious tactile experience, where the solid aluminium ring provides subtle haptic feedback as the volume is raised or lowered.

Beoremote Halo comes with four favourites buttons, allowing users to access their favourite music with a simple tap of the finger. This one-touch approach to music has been core to Bang & Olufsen’s DNA for more than 80 years. The favourites buttons also allow users to switch seamlessly between TuneIn, Spotify, or Deezer. The display clearly identifies the content being played and also shows a list of connected devices, allowing users to control their multiroom experience. To turn off all the music in the home, users simply press and hold the standby button.

Beoremote Halo, which retails for S$1,200, comes in natural, brass tone and bronze tone anodised aluminium and is available now at Bang & Olufsen Grand Hyatt flagship store in Singapore. It is designed to pair with any Beolab speaker e.g. Beolab 90, Beolab 50, Beolab 18, Beosound Shape as well as a wide portfolio of the multiroom speaker range.
